Tagreeda Profile

Tagreeda is a 4 year old bay mare. Tagreeda is trained by M G Price, at Caulfield and owned by Sheikh Mohammed Bin Khalifa Al Maktoum.

Tagreeda’s last race event was at 29/08/2018 and it has not been nominated for any upcoming race.

Tagreeda Racing Form

Career form is 2 wins, 2 seconds, 1 thirds from 11 starts with a lifetime career prize money of $62,350.

With a 18% Win Percentage and 45% Place Percentage. Tagreeda's last race event was at Sandown-Hillside.

Exposed form for its last starts is 8-4-8-9-5.
